How To Choose a Roofing Company

Roof installation is a large home improvement project that can cost an amount in the tens of thousands range. It's crucial to research and find the most skilled and reliable roofing professional for the job. Here are the key factors to consider when choosing a roofing contractor.

  • Experience and credentials: Companies operating for over a decade have a proven history and track record of expert service and happy clients. Make sure any provider you consider is properly licensed, bonded, and insured. Ask about professional certifications, such as those from the National Roofing Contractors Association.
  • Detailed written estimate: Reputable roofers will offer a comprehensive written estimate that outlines the full scope of the work, materials requirements, and total cost without hidden fees. Avoid vague bids or quotes that seem dramatically low or high.
  • Warranties and guarantees: A reliable roofer will provide robust manufacturer warranties that cover shingles for 30+ years along with at least a 5-year workmanship warranty on labor. Be wary of shorter guarantees.
  • Responsiveness and communication: Your contractor should maintain regular contact throughout, from the estimate to the completion of the project. A representative should respond to questions quickly and handle any issues while working.
  • References and reviews: Vet companies thoroughly by looking on Google, Yelp, or the Better Business Bureau (BBB) to see that they have a history of consistently positive feedback. You can also request recent local references to learn more.
  • Roofing materials and products: Quality roofing companies sell quality materials that can handle Fairview Shores' weather and last a long time. Be careful of contractors offering extremely inexpensive or generic options. Inspect shingle samples before committing.

Signs Your Roof Needs Repair or Replacement

Though most homeowners don't think about their roof every single day, a roof plays an important role in keeping a home safe and secure. Be on the lookout for these signs that your roof might need professional attention.

Roof Age

Your roof's age and material are key factors. Asphalt shingles, the most popular residential roofing material, generally last 20–25 years before needing replacement. Have your roof evaluated if it’s approaching or past this lifespan to determine if it needs to be replaced.

Leaks or Water Stains in Your Home

One of the most obvious signs of a roof problem is leaking. Stains on walls, ceilings, and insulation — or in your attic — usually mean that water is seeping through worn or damaged shingles. Don't ignore small leaks, because even these can lead to mold growth and roof deterioration.

Exposed Roof Decking Underneath Shingles

If you can see roof deck boards or sheathing under shingles, it shows that those shingles are severely curling or losing their seal. This means the shingles likely need replacement. Shingles need to lie flat to stop water from entering your home.

Cracked, Broken, or Missing Shingles

Examine your shingles closely from a steady ladder or while on the ground. Look for shingles that have cracked or no longer have their protective granule layer. High winds can cause roof damage over time. To keep your roof in working order, replace any missing shingles, or ones that are openly gaping.

Flashing Deterioration Around Roof Penetrations

Metal flashing on your roof seals off vents, valleys, chimneys, and other areas where water can penetrate the roofing system. If the flashing is developing cracks, peeling away, or deteriorating over time, it may leak. Promptly take care of any flashing issues.

Sagging Roof Line

If you notice your roofline sagging or sloping unevenly, it could indicate a problem with the structure that requires professional inspection. A sagging roof deck will worsen over time if not given proper reinforcement or replaced entirely.

In Florida, contractors can be registered or certified. Registered contractors work in a specific city or county and must meet certain competencies and obtain business insurance. Certified contractors can work throughout the state, and have to meet additional requirements, such as holding roofing insurance. Both types of license are handled through the Department of Business and Professional Regulation.
